Heavy Equipment Operator - Kansas City, United States - Scrap Management Industries
Description
Job Type Full-timeDescriptionMidwest Scrap Management is looking for a Heavy Equipment Operator.This position requires the expert, safe operation of various types of heavy equipment to move, organize, stack, load and unload processed and unprocessed scrap metal.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
The following are general responsibilities associated with the position as directed: Operates heavy equipment in compliance with the company operating safety policies and proceduresMoves and positions raw materials and finished components with use of material moving equipmentConducts routine equipment inspections and preventative maintenance on equipment; maintains accurate records in the form of pre and post shift inspectionsMonitor and maintain all production equipment, i.e.
material handlers, front end wheel loaders, track excavator with shear attachment, semi tractors, rail car mover, skid steer, balers, shears, etc.
Properly follow company and OSHA safety proceduresExpected to report any defects or needed repairs to supervisor immediatelyWilling to cross-train in other positions and assists other employees as neededEnsure a clean, safe and orderly workplace; clean and prepare sites by removing debris and possible hazards.
